Since 2014, Zhanxiang has operated under the ISO 9001 quality management standard, ensuring
strict control across the full production lifecycle-from raw material sourcing to product
delivery and after-sales support. In 2022, we advanced our commitment to quality and automotive
industry standards by achieving IATF 16949 certification. In 2025, we expanded our focus to
include environmental and occupational health standards, successfully obtaining ISO 14000 and
ISO 45001 (formerly OHSAS 18000) certifications.
